Statement of Faith

  • We believe the Bible to be the inspired, the only infallible, authoritative Word of God. (Psalm 119:89, Isaiah 40:8, 2 Timothy 3:16-17, 1 Thessalonians 2:13).

  • We believe that there is one God, eternally existent in three persons: Father, Son and Holy Spirit. (Deuteronomy 6:4, Isaiah 9:6, Matthew 28:18-20, John 16:7).

  • We believe in the deity of our Lord Jesus Christ, in His virgin birth, in His sinless life, in His miracles, in His vicarious and atoning death through His shed blood, in His bodily resurrection, in His ascension to the right hand of the Father, and in His personal return in power and glory. (John 10:30, John 14:6-7, Colossians 1:15-20, Isaiah 7:14, Luke 1:26-33, 2 Corinthians 5:22, 1 Peter 2:22, Isaiah 35:5-6, 1 Peter 2:24, Isaiah 53:5, John 20:14-18, Matthew 28:6, Mark 16:19, Mark 14:62, Revelation 19:11-21).

  • We believe that for the salvation of lost and sinful people, regeneration by the Holy Spirit is absolutely essential. (Romans 8:2-6, Romans 10:9).

  • We believe in the present ministry of the Holy Spirit by whose indwelling the Christian is enabled to live a godly life. (Galatians 5:18, 22-23, Ephesians 1:13).

  • We believe in the resurrection of both the saved and the lost; they that are saved unto the resurrection of life and they that are lost unto the resurrection of eternal separation from God. (John 11:25-26, 2 Corinthians 5:10, Revelation 20:11-15).

  • ​We believe in the spiritual unity of believers in our Lord Jesus Christ. (John 10:16, Ephesians 4:3-6).
